结构体struct是复合数据结构,它是由其它数据类型组合而来。其它语言也有类似的数据结构,不过可能有不同的名称,例如object、record等。
SEC指控Consensys,Reth(Paradigm的Rust执行层客户端)已经准备就绪
深入以太坊虚拟机,查看了 EVM 如何执行字节码。研究了 Gas,EVM 的记账机制。
Sui是一个专注于扩展和性能的区块链平台。它由MystenLabs开发,旨在解决当前区块链面临的可扩展性和效率问题。Sui使用Move作为编程语言,专为区块链和智能合约设计,强调安全性和可验证性。本文不涉及Move的语法讲解,仅演示Sui的示例合约部署。
Aave就相当于去中心化交易所中的一个银行,在其中用户可以进行一系列的资金操作,下面从其两个主要的功能阐述:借贷、存款。借贷在Aave中借贷有两种方式:借款(有抵押物的)、闪电贷(无抵押物的)。闪电贷AaveV2的闪电贷感觉没有什么特别的地方,就是在一个区块交易内完成借出和还入两个
本文提供了对智能合约暂停功能设计的一种改进方案
Solana 开发全面指南:使用 React、Anchor、Rust 和 Phantom 进行全栈开发
FHE全同态加密介绍——小白版
ERC-1363 标准在 ERC-20 标准上的补充,可以在转账的时候触发 Hook 的调用。
截止到2024年6月,Uniswap已经推出三个上线的生产版本。第四个版本目前还在开发阶段
第8条:熟悉引用和指针类型在一般的编程中,引用(reference)是一种间接访问数据结构的方式,它与拥有该数据结构的变量是分开的。在实践中,引用通常由指针(pointer)来实现。指针是一个数字,它的值是数据结构的变量在内存中的地址。现代CPU通常会对指针施加一些限制:内存地
理解比特币是如何转移的。
本文是根据比特币铭文协议Ordinal创始人CaseyRodarmor 制作的视频,手把手教大家安装比特币全节点和Ord索引器。
所有的程序都必须和计算机内存打交道,如何从内存中申请空间来存放程序的运行内容,如何在不需要的时候释放这些空间,成了重中之重,也是所有编程语言设计的难点之一。
状态过期和历史过期以增强以太坊的去中心化
EIP-3074 和 EIP-7702 都旨在使以太坊钱包更加用户友好,并提升 web3 应用程序的用户体验。 然而他们使用了不同的实现方式。
EIP-6963 解决同时多个钱包提供者的烦恼,本文介绍如在在前端 React应用中集成 EIP-6963 。
在这份指南中,深入探讨以太坊共识和 Lido 的提款模块的复杂性。了解从信标链到验证者生命周期的关键组件,以及它们如何塑造协议的安全性和功能
了解 Lido 协议发展的整个过程,揭示 Lido 如何适应以太坊的变化,将深入探讨协议本身的机制,用简单的术语描述其架构和复杂操作原理。
一直对zkVM比较感兴趣。zkVM将零知识证明技术应用带入一个新的时代。几年前,应用零知识证明技术需要理解复杂的零知识证明算法,并且需要将证明业务逻辑描述成“电路”。zkVM将这些复杂的逻辑封装。基于zkVM,业务开发人员可以采用熟悉的高级语言轻松完成证明业务的描述。目前市面上zkVM层出不穷。先看
扫一扫 - 使用登链小程序
59 篇文章,299 学分
35 篇文章,244 学分
108 篇文章,224 学分
21 篇文章,196 学分
9 篇文章,163 学分